The controversy surrounding the endorsement of Denis Kadima's team has given birth to a new platform, the objective of which is to oppose the politicization of the Ceni.

This platform brings together very widely with the opposition, religious and civil society.

The Social and Political Forces of the Nation is the name given to this platform.

"

 It brings together movements, associations, political parties and political groupings, without discrimination, 

" says Maître Jean-Bosco Lalo Kpasha.

According to the president of the national office of the Social and Political Forces of the Nation, his objective is the depoliticization of the Independent National Electoral Commission (Ceni).

Peaceful march on November 6

Indeed, the presence of

Denis Kadima

at the head of the new team of the commission continues to arouse various reactions within the public.

In addition to dividing religious denominations, this presence also opposes political parties including

those of the Sacred Union

, some believing that the new president of the Ceni is very close to the President of the Republic.

There is in particular Moïse Katumbi 

who continues his consultations

in the capital.

The leader of the party Together for the Republic, spoke against the endorsement of Denis Kadima as president of the Ceni.

He is trying to find a concerted position within his party on the electoral process.

The new platform is based on two structures: the laity of

the Catholic Church

and those of

the Protestant Church

, the two religious denominations which are very reluctant to appoint Denis Kadima.

A first mobilization is scheduled for Saturday, November 6.

The platform calls for a peaceful march across the country.
